2625f776ec250538829e2af36f1f177dcc11026e3ff548709120146f5104f6ab

1372139 (432112 blocks ago)

⏴ Block 1372138 (0842919d...df6) | Block 1372140 ⏵ | Latest block ⏭

Metadata

7/24/23, 10:00 AM UTC (600d 3:45:28 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details